An electric scooter rider was killed Wednesday morning on Road 44 (Derech HaShiv'a) in Azor, after being struck by a vehicle. Paramedics who arrived at the scene declared the rider, estimated to be in his 60s, dead. The incident follows a pattern of e-scooter fatalities on Israeli roads: The Zioneer reported earlier on Wednesday (at 02:55) a separate serious-injury hit involving an e-scooter in the same town. A previous fatal case in early June led to a reckless homicide indictment against a driver. Israeli road-safety data shows a rise in e-scooter-related casualties, particularly at junctions and on main arteries. Police said they are investigating the circumstances of this morning's crash.
